Barbara completely fills her mug with a mixture of 15ml hoy chocolate and 35 ml of cream. what percent of the mixture is not cho

colate?
Mathematics
1 answer:
lora16 [44]3 years ago
7 0
There is 50mL of liquid altogether.
35mL is not chocolate.
35/50 is not chocolate.
35/50 = 70/100
70/100 = 70%
70% of the mixture is not chocolate.
